Blake Lively and Justin Baldoni have resolved the sexual harassment lawsuit initiated by the actress.
Attorneys for both parties issued a joint statement expressing hope for closure and a peaceful, respectful path forward for everyone involved.
Previously, a federal judge in New York had dismissed Lively's sexual harassment allegations, which were first brought in 2024. However, two retaliation claims were permitted to proceed. Some of the sexual harassment allegations could be presented to a jury to support these remaining claims.
Baldoni and his production company, Wayfarer Studios, had filed a countersuit against Lively and her husband, Ryan Reynolds. They accused the couple of defamation and extortion, but these counterclaims were dismissed in June.
A trial for the unresolved claims had been slated to commence later this month.
